Abstract

PURPOSE:To deodorize and to sterilize food and drink, to make its taste mild and easily absorbable in the body, by applying a high electrostatic potential to food and drink to be treated by an AC high electrostatic potential generator at a given interval or at a pulse interval. CONSTITUTION:Leaves of tea, etc. are put in the container 21 for treating solid drink and food, and an AC high electrostatic potential (e.g., potential >=5,000V) is applied to them by the AC high electrostatic potential generator 10 at a given interval. Water and other components contained in the leaves of tea, etc. are ionized. An extracted solution of the leaves of tea, etc. is sent from the receiver 33 to the subtank 37, fed to the liquid treating container 40, the AC high electrostatic potential is applied to air, the ozonized air is raised as bubbles from the bottom of the air pipe 47. The extracted solution is ionized, water and various kinds of coponents are ionized.

Next, an example will be explained in which the method of the present invention is applied to Chinese tea having a unique odor using the above-mentioned apparatus. First, tea leaves are placed in the solid food processing container 21 for 8 minutes, the switch 18 is connected to the terminal 18-1, and the AC high electrostatic potential generator 10 is heated for a predetermined interval, for example, 30 seconds. Then, an AC aged potential, for example, t of 5.000 V or more is applied to the tea leaves. Here, high-potential alternating current radio waves ionize the water and other components of the tea leaves. After processing, the valve 23 is opened and the tea leaves are taken out from the discharge port 22 onto the receiver 29. By pouring regular hot water over the tea leaves as they are, the unique odor disappears, and you get ionized tea with a mellow taste that is easily absorbed by the body, so you can store it in a sealed container and use it immediately after processing. .
